At least two children are wounded and the bus driver is killed when an explosion hits a school bus in northwest Pakistan. Police have detained at least one man at the scene.

An explosion hit a school bus in the northwestern Pakistani city of Peshawar on Monday. Police say two children were wounded and the bus driver was killed.

Local media showed at least one person being detained at the scene.

Pakistan's government is facing a growing threat from what officials and analysts call a growing network of militant groups.

It's a murky mix that includes al Qaeda, Pakistani Taliban militants and other groups.

Some are anti-Western while others are driven mostly by sectarian hatred.

Pakistani authorities are on alert for sectarian violence during Moharram, the holiest month for Shi'ite Muslims, which is currently underway.

Sunni militant groups often attack Shi'ite gatherings during this period.
